I am Paula from NC.  I am almost 7 years out.  I have had very good results.  Had a scare when I gained weight, but lost some of it once I got more active and ate healthier.  The surgery still works!  I'd like to lose about 10 more.  I went from 214 to 107 to 156 to 139.  This is over the space of almost 7 years.  I would like to get some plastics done if I ever get the bucks.  Clothes do wonders to hide the flab lol.  Anyway, hello!
